Baseball Recap: St. Paul Swordsmen vs. Paraclete Spirits
St. Paul hadn't done well against Paraclete recently (they were 0-4 in their previous four mat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Tuesday. The St. Paul Swordsmen walked away with a 5-2 win over the Paraclete Spirits.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Swordsmen.

Jonathan Lara looked comfortable as he tossed 3.1 innings while giving up no earned runs off two hits.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't given up more than two hits any time he's pitched this season.
On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Troy Sibolboro, who got on base in all three of his plate appearances with one home run, three RBI, and one stolen base. He is on a roll when it comes to stolen bases, as he's now snagged at least one in each of the last three games he's played. Fernie Soto was another key player, scoring a run while going 2-for-3.
St. Paul hit smart and finished the game with only two strikeouts.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Paraclete struck out seven times.
St. Paul's victory was their first in the league, bumping their league record up to 1-2 and their overall record up to 7-3. As for Paraclete, they are on a six-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 3-7.
Coincidentally, St. Paul and Paraclete will both be playing Cajon the next time they take the field. St. Paul will host Cajon at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day, while Paraclete will host them at 3:15 p.m. on Thursday.
